Get PriceMar 29, 2018 · Uranium recovery involves one of the following extraction processes. In a conventional uranium mine and mill, uranium ore is extracted from the Earth, typically through deep underground shafts or shallow open pits. The ore is transported to a mill, where it is crushed and undergoes a chemical process to remove the uranium.

Get PriceUranium mining is the process of extraction of uranium ore from the ground. The worldwide production of uranium in 2015 amounted to 60,496 tonnes. Kazakhstan, Canada, and Australia are the top three producers and together account for 70% of world uranium production.

Get PriceOil sands slurry produced in the Slurry Preparation Plant (SPP) contains about 50-55% sand and less than 10% bitumen. Get PriceA description is given of direct fluorination of preconcentrated uranium ores in order to obtain the hexafluoride. After normal sulfuric acid treatment of the ore to eliminate silica, the uranium is precipitated by lime to obtain either impure calcium uranate of medium grade, or containing around 10% of uranium.

Get PriceUranium Wikipedia. Uranium ore is mined in several ways by open pit, underground, in-situ leaching, and borehole mining (see uranium mining). Low-grade uranium ore mined typically contains 0.01 to 0.25% uranium oxides. Extensive measures must be employed to extract the metal from its ore.
Get PriceThe basic mineral processing techniques involved in the milling or concentrating of ore are crushing, then separation of the ore from the impurities. (1) Separation can be accomplished by any one or more of the following methods including media separation, gravity separation, froth flotation, or magnetic separation. (4,5,6)
